Endangered Species “ Volcano Rabbit”

   The Volcano Rabbit is an animal that inhabits Valley of Mexico on the east and south, near Mexico City. (www.animalinfo.org/species/). It is a beautiful type of rabbit, it is harmless, to any person or animal, and it only eats grass and any other kind of plants. Volcano Rabbit
   The cause of the Volcano Rabbit being endangered is very frustrating and annoying. One of the causes of its population decreasing is serious threats of habitat degradation and target shooting.  The habitat degradations is thanks to forest fires, development and agriculture, over-exploitation of timber and cutting of zacaton grasses which is the main food of the Volcano Rabbit.(www.animalinfo.org/species/). The other factor which is target shooting is the one which is most annoying, since it is the one easiest to be stopped, but thanks to lack of interest and ignorance of certain people they continue with this sport or hobby.
